When Should My Youngster Have Their Initial Oral See?

It additionally helps your kid come to be knowledgeable about the dental workplace environment, minimizing anxiousness during future check outs.



Throughout the initial oral check out, the dentist will certainly examine your child's mouth, gums, and any kind of arising teeth. They'll likewise review crucial subjects such as teething, correct nourishment for dental health and wellness, and how to prevent tooth cavities. The dental practitioner may show exactly how to cleanse your child's teeth effectively and attend to any kind of questions or problems you may have regarding your youngster's dental health and wellness.

What Are Common Pediatric Dental Procedures?

These cleansings are normally executed by an oral hygienist who'll also give valuable ideas on appropriate oral health methods for your youngster.

Oral fillings are common treatments to treat cavities in youngsters. The dental professional will certainly eliminate the decayed part of the tooth and fill the room with a product such as composite resin or amalgam to recover the tooth's function and stop additional degeneration.

Fluoride treatments are one more typical procedure in pediatric dental care. Fluoride assists to enhance the enamel of the teeth, making them a lot more immune to degeneration. These treatments are frequently advised by dental practitioners to assist stop cavities and keep great oral wellness.

Various other typical pediatric oral treatments might include dental sealers, removals, and orthodontic evaluations. These procedures aim to ensure your child's teeth are healthy and properly lined up as they grow.

Just How Can I Aid My Kid With Oral Hygiene in your home?



To aid preserve your child's oral wellness in between oral brows through, making sure proper oral health in your home is essential. Beginning by educating your child the relevance of brushing their teeth a minimum of two times a day with fluoride tooth paste. Supervise them while cleaning to see to it they're using the proper strategy and getting to all locations of their mouth. Urge them to spit out the tooth paste rather than swallowing it.

In addition to cleaning, make flossing a daily behavior for your youngster, particularly once their teeth begin to touch. Flossing helps eliminate food fragments and plaque from in between the teeth where a toothbrush can't get to. Think about using enjoyable seasoned floss or floss choices to make the procedure extra enjoyable for your child.

Limit sweet treats and drinks in your child's diet to avoid dental caries. Go with water as the primary drink and deal healthy and balanced snacks like fruits, veggies, and cheese. Ultimately, timetable routine dental exams to ensure your child's dental wellness gets on track.
